RFTYT Passive Components RF Flanged Resistor Microwave RF Resistor Rf

The RFTYT Passive Components RF Flanged Resistor is a versatile surface-mount resistor designed for high-frequency and microwave applications. With a resistance range of 100–400Ω and ±5% tolerance, it ensures precision in critical circuits while its metallic construction enhances thermal management. The durable label and mounting holes enable seamless integration into compact electronic systems.
